Scam 2003 serves as the spiritual successor to the hit series Scam 1992. Produced by Applause Entertainment and streaming on Sony LIV, the show is based on Sanjay Singh's book, Telgi Scam: Reporter's Diary. The Plot Context
Episode 6 falls within "Volume 2" of the first season. While Volume 1 established Abdul Karim Telgi’s rise from a fruit seller at Khanapur station to a sophisticated counterfeiter, Episode 6 dives into the beginning of the end. At this stage, Telgi's empire has become so massive that it is impossible to hide. The episode focuses on:
Political Entanglements: The deepening web of corruption involving high-ranking police officers and politicians who were on Telgi’s payroll.
Internal Friction: The strain within Telgi's own "family" of associates as the pressure from investigative agencies like the SIT (Special Investigation Team) begins to mount.
Health and Hubris: Glimpses into Telgi's declining health (he suffered from diabetes and hypertension) and his increasing overconfidence, which eventually leads to critical mistakes. The Real History: Who was Abdul Karim Telgi?
The series is grounded in one of the most audacious financial crimes in Indian history. According to Wikipedia's entry on Abdul Karim Telgi, the scam was estimated to be worth roughly ₹30,000 crore (approximately $4 billion).
The Method: Telgi didn't just forge stamp papers; he acquired the very machinery used by the Government of India to print them. By creating an artificial shortage of authentic stamps, he flooded the market with his own sophisticated fakes.
